Transaction 3043c4c984004adad6113ced66dee5dc4e97be33249f25455dbc32ecd6b6233a

2 Input
2 Outputs
  • 3043c4c984004adad6113ced66dee5dc4e97be33249f25455dbc32ecd6b6233a:0
  • value  7176836
    address  3PaQZdkvyZCctYHXE2HC2kM3LnZRU3s2Kj
  • 3043c4c984004adad6113ced66dee5dc4e97be33249f25455dbc32ecd6b6233a:1
  • value  12101183
    address  bc1q3x7wr2f085wpqm75lcft7vmhd2ucxjvau6x8n9